You did not need 8GB of memory or a 128GB card.... 2GB on the Rpi is still overkill and the smallest card will be big enough.. I used to buy 8GB cards, but I think now a 16GB card is the smallest you can get at most places.

So, if you've got a small SD card laying around... a 4,8, 16, 32 GB will all work... No need to wait or waste the 128 GB card on an RPi.
